AutoCAD is Autodesk's 2D and 3D drafting platform for CAD workflows across architecture, engineering, construction, manufacturing, and related technical fields.

AutoCAD matters because drawings and DWG-centered workflows are persistent coordination artifacts across firms, contractors, regulators, and asset owners.

LibreCAD

LibreCAD is a free, open-source 2D CAD application for Windows, macOS, and Linux.

FreeCAD

FreeCAD is an open-source parametric 3D modeler focused on real-world objects and technical design.

Open CAD Fabrication Commons

A shared ecosystem of open CAD models, validated DXF/STEP exports, local fabrication recipes, and paid support providers could shift some drafting value from proprietary licenses toward reusable community-owned design libraries.

Thesis

AutoCAD's strongest market power weakens where drawings become portable, inspectable, and directly connected to local fabrication instead of being trapped inside one vendor's drafting environment.

Bitcoin / decentralization role

The decentralization role is open coordination around portable design files and local fabrication capacity, not Bitcoin. Designers, workshops, and maintainers coordinate around shared files, version history, and reproducible manufacturing instructions.

Coordination mechanism

Designers publish and fork parametric models, fabricators advertise supported machines and tolerances, and buyers select verified local producers for small runs, repair parts, or custom components.

Verification / trust model

Trust comes from reproducible geometry, published source files, fabrication logs, peer review, reputation history, and test builds; fraud is constrained by attaching deliverables to inspectable files and verifiable shipment or pickup records.

Failure modes

  • Professional liability and code compliance may still require certified proprietary workflows.
  • Open designs can fragment without strong maintainers, documentation, and compatibility testing.
  • DWG-heavy legacy projects may remain difficult to migrate cleanly.

Adoption path

  • Start with hobbyist, education, repair, and small-shop fabrication use cases where proprietary collaboration requirements are lighter.
  • Build libraries of validated parts and drawings that export reliably across FreeCAD, LibreCAD, and commercial tools.
  • Add paid support, training, and certification layers for small firms that want open workflows without absorbing all migration risk.
